The current FTIR search does not support a firm compound-level identification. Although the nearest library name is 4-Nitropyridine, all reported library similarities are 0.000 and no direct reference or related-literature evidence independently supports that assignment. The observed spectrum is sparse, with notable bands near 1571 cm-1, out-of-plane aromatic-region bands at 749, 799, and 873 cm-1, and a series of features in the 1892-2168 cm-1 region that are not sufficient on their own to establish a specific structure. Taken together, the most defensible conclusion is a broad material direction: a nitrogen-containing aromatic small molecule, possibly a substituted heteroaromatic ring compound, rather than a confirmed match to 4-Nitropyridine
Recommended next steps: Re-acquire the FTIR spectrum with improved signal quality and full baseline correction, especially to verify the weak or unusual features in the 1892-2168 cm-1 region. Check specifically for the characteristic paired nitro stretching region expected near the mid-1500 and mid-1300 cm-1 ranges if 4-Nitropyridine remains under consideration. Obtain complementary Raman or mass spectrometry data to determine whether the sample is a small substituted heteroaromatic molecule rather than a polymeric or highly oxygenated aromatic material. If enough sample is available, compare directly against an authentic reference spectrum for 4-Nitropyridine under the same measurement conditions.
